MD485 RS-485 Multidrop Interface

Step 1 – Set Up Base MD485

a. Connect serial cable from PC COM port to base MD485 RS-232 port.

b. Plug transformer into AC outlet and plug barrel connector into base

MD485 “DC Pwr” jack. You will see both red LEDs light immediately
for 1 second. Both LEDs then begin to flash once every 2 seconds.

c. Using DevConfig or the MD485 setup menu as explained in Section 3.1.3,

change the active ports of the base MD485 to “RS-232 and RS-485.” All
other options can be left in their default state.

Step 2 – Set Up Remote MD485

a. Connect SC12 cable from datalogger CS I/O port to remote MD485

CS I/O port. Current datalogger/wiring panel CS I/O ports apply power to
the remote MD485.

With older dataloggers lacking 12 V on pin 8 (see Table 2), you can
power the MD485 using a Field Power Cable (see above hardware list)
between the datalogger’s 12 V (output) terminals and the MD485’s “DC
Pwr” jack.

When you connect power to the MD485 (through the SC12 cable or the
optional Field Power Cable) you should see the power-up sequence of the
red LEDs described in Step 1 (assuming datalogger is powered).
